本科车辆工程大学生该如何学习自动驾驶相关知识?

时间: 2023-05-27 17:01:18 浏览: 100
1. 学习相关基础知识:自动驾驶技术涉及到计算机视觉、控制理论、机器学习等多个学科的知识。作为车辆工程专业的学生,需要首先掌握相关基础知识,例如控制理论、传感器原理、计算机编程等。 2. 参与实践项目:通过参加相关实践项目,如比赛、研究、实习等,锻炼自己的技能并且积累经验。可以通过院校的机器人方向、智能车方向、专业课程设计等来积累实践经验和技能。 3. 参与开源项目:参与AI和自动驾驶相关的开源社区项目,如GitHub等,一方面可以了解行业最新的技术动态,另一方面可以学习到其他开发者的实践经验和新的代码技巧。 4. 学习课程:参加开设自动驾驶相关的学术会议和课程,如自驾之路、自动驾驶浅谈、自动驾驶软硬件高阶训练等等,充分利用专业的学术资源。 5. 关注行业发展,了解新技术新概念:关注行业内领先企业(如Tesla、Waymo、百度Apollo等)的发展动态以及新概念(如L4/L5级别自动驾驶、V2X通信等),掌握行业前沿的研究成果和趋势,从而更好地为将来的职业规划做好准备。
相关问题

自动驾驶系统工程师知识体系

自动驾驶系统工程师需要掌握以下知识体系: 1. 汽车控制系统:掌握汽车电子控制系统、传感器、执行器等基础知识,了解汽车动力学和控制方法。 2. 计算机视觉:了解图像处理、计算机视觉、目标检测和跟踪、三维重建等技术。 3. 机器学习和深度学习:了解机器学习和深度学习的常用算法和模型,包括分类、回归、聚类、神经网络等。 4. 算法和数据结构:了解常见的算法和数据结构,如排序、搜索、图论等。 5. 软件工程:掌握软件开发流程和工具,如需求分析、设计、编码、测试、集成等。 6. 操作系统和嵌入式系统:了解操作系统和嵌入式系统的基础知识,掌握Linux、RTOS等操作系统。 7. 通信和网络:了解通信和网络的基础知识,包括TCP/IP协议、无线通信、车联网等。 8. 安全性和可靠性:掌握安全性和可靠性设计原则,了解常见的安全攻击和防御方法。 9. 法规和标准:了解自动驾驶相关的法规和标准,如ISO 26262、SAE J3016等。 10. 项目管理:掌握项目管理的基础知识,包括需求管理、进度管理、风险管理等。 以上是自动驾驶系统工程师需要掌握的知识体系,不同公司和岗位对知识体系的要求可能会有所不同。

学习自动驾驶需要学习哪些知识,有没有具体学习资源参考

学习自动驾驶需要掌握的知识非常多,包括机器学习、计算机视觉、传感器融合、控制理论等多个领域。以下是一些常用的学习资源: 1. Coursera上的自动驾驶课程:https://www.coursera.org/learn/intro-self-driving-cars 2. Udacity上的自动驾驶课程:https://www.udacity.com/course/self-driving-car-engineer-nanodegree--nd013 3. 美国斯坦福大学开设的自动驾驶课程:http://cars.stanford.edu/courses/cs221/ 4. 机器学习相关的书籍:《机器学习》、《统计学习方法》、《深度学习》等 5. 计算机视觉相关的书籍:《计算机视觉:模型、学习和推理》、《计算机视觉:算法与应用》等 此外,还可以参考各大互联网公司的技术博客和论文,如Google、Uber、Tesla等,了解他们在自动驾驶领域的最新研究成果。

相关推荐

最新推荐

recommend-type

自动驾驶车辆道路测试能力评估内容与方法.pdf

自动驾驶车辆道路测试能力评估内容与方法。本标准规定了自动驾驶车辆道路测试能力评估内容与方法。 本标准适用于对申请道路测试的自动驾驶车辆的自动驾驶能力的评估,评估结果可作为自动驾驶车辆能否进行道路测试的...
recommend-type

北京市自动驾驶车辆道路测试报告(2019).pdf

2020年3月发布,《北京市自动驾驶车辆道路测试报告(2019年)》显示,截止2019年年底,各企业进行自动驾驶路测的车辆累计达到77辆,测试总里程超过104万公里。2019年全年测试总里程达88.66万公里,测试车辆为73辆,...
recommend-type

智能网联汽车自动驾驶功能测试规程.docx

搭载先进的车载传感器、控制器、执行器等装置,并融合现代通信与网络技术,实现车与 X(人、 车、路、云端等)智能信息交换、共享,具备复杂环境感知、智能决策、协同控制等功能,可实现“安全、高效、舒适、节能”...
recommend-type

基于交通事故的自动驾驶虚拟测试方法研究

传统的实车测试方法难以验证自动驾驶汽车面对复杂、危险场景时的安全性和可靠性。 虚拟测试方法因测试效率高、 成本低等优点, 成为自动驾驶测试评价的重要手段。 本文从中国交通事故深入研究 ( China In-Depth ...
recommend-type

无人驾驶铰接式车辆强化学习路径跟踪控制算法_邵俊恺.pdf

针对无人驾驶铰接式运输车辆无人驾驶智能控制问题,提出了一种无人驾驶自适应 PID 路径跟踪控制算法。首先推导了铰接车的运动学模型,根据该模型建立实际行驶路径与参考路径偏差的模型,以 PID 控制算法为基础,设计...
recommend-type

zigbee-cluster-library-specification

最新的zigbee-cluster-library-specification说明文档。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

【实战演练】MATLAB用遗传算法改进粒子群GA-PSO算法

![MATLAB智能算法合集](https://static.fuxi.netease.com/fuxi-official/web/20221101/83f465753fd49c41536a5640367d4340.jpg) # 2.1 遗传算法的原理和实现 遗传算法(GA)是一种受生物进化过程启发的优化算法。它通过模拟自然选择和遗传机制来搜索最优解。 **2.1.1 遗传算法的编码和解码** 编码是将问题空间中的解表示为二进制字符串或其他数据结构的过程。解码是将编码的解转换为问题空间中的实际解的过程。常见的编码方法包括二进制编码、实数编码和树形编码。 **2.1.2 遗传算法的交叉和
recommend-type

openstack的20种接口有哪些

以下是OpenStack的20种API接口: 1. Identity (Keystone) API 2. Compute (Nova) API 3. Networking (Neutron) API 4. Block Storage (Cinder) API 5. Object Storage (Swift) API 6. Image (Glance) API 7. Telemetry (Ceilometer) API 8. Orchestration (Heat) API 9. Database (Trove) API 10. Bare Metal (Ironic) API 11. DNS
recommend-type

JSBSim Reference Manual

JSBSim参考手册,其中包含JSBSim简介,JSBSim配置文件xml的编写语法,编程手册以及一些应用实例等。其中有部分内容还没有写完,估计有生之年很难看到完整版了,但是内容还是很有参考价值的。